What is the admission criteria for B.Pharma. at Delhi Institute of Rural Development, Holambi Khurd for reserved category students?
-
1 Answer
-
Admission to B.Pharm at Delhi Institute of Rural Development, Holambi Khurd is based on scores obtained in the IPU Common Entrance Test (IPU CET) & the eligibility criteria is 10+2 with Physics, Chemistry, Mathematics (P.C.M) & or Biology (P.C.B / P.C.M.B.) as optional subjects individually. For reserved category students, the admission criteria will be as per the guidelines of the Government of India & the Institute's policies.

For the Bachelor of Pharmacy (B.Pharma.) program, the Delhi Institute of Rural Development (DIRD), Holambi Khurd is PCI approved. The estimated annual cost for the B.Pharma programme is about INR 90,000 to INR 1,10,000.
It takes 4 years completing and includes such subjects as pharmaceutical sciences, medicinal chemistry, and pharmacology. This include, examination fees, laboratory charges and books which may cost upto INR 10,000 – 20,000 per anum.
The best source of information concerning these fees should be approached through a direct contact with the institute or by employing a visit to the campus office.
